What are the lumps of molten rock thrown out of a Volcano called?

Geography
2 answers:
Naddik [55]3 years ago
7 0
Lava Bombs, when a volcano erupts it throws out lava bombs.
TEA [102]3 years ago
5 0
<span>These are known as tephra, pyroclats or more generally as volcanic bombs.</span>

4.3 Give THREE sources of inputs of GIS?
vredina [299]

Explanation:

A GIS is a geographic information system environment. It is made up of the people, hardware and the software.

The system helps to store, analyze, interpret and visualize geographical data in the software environment. It has the ability of superimposing different layers on top of one another.

Source of data for GIS area;

  • Paper maps
  • Satellite imagery
  • GPS devices
  • Digital maps
  • Excel data
